> PipelinedSorter doesn't use number of items when creating SortSpan
> -------------------------------------------------------------------
>
> Key: TEZ-2604
> URL: https://issues.apache.org/jira/browse/TEZ-2604
> Project: Apache Tez
> Issue Type: Bug
> Affects Versions: 0.8.0
> Reporter: Tsuyoshi Ozawa
> Assignee: Tsuyoshi Ozawa
> Attachments: TEZ-2604.001.patch
>
>
> {quote}
> int items = 1024*1024;
> int perItem = 16;
> if(span.length() != 0) {
> items = span.length();
> perItem = span.kvbuffer.limit()/items;
> items = (int) ((span.capacity)/(METASIZE+perItem));
> if(items > 1024*1024) {
> // our goal is to have 1M splits and sort early
> items = 1024*1024;
> }
> }
> Preconditions.checkArgument(listIterator.hasNext(), "block iterator should not
be empty");
> span = new SortSpan((ByteBuffer)listIterator.next().clear(), (1024*1024),
> perItem, ConfigUtils.getIntermediateOutputKeyComparator(this.conf));
> {quote}
> Should we use items instead of (1024*1024)?
